Contact submit Requirement Login

SRR6038680Y

1 match, viewing page 1 of 1
Filters
Description:

FIXED IND 68UH 750MA 234 MOHM

Qty
2,519
24-December-2024 00:59:54
Copyright © 2017 Perfect Parts Corp